Abstract

BACKGROUND

Emotional cognition and effective interpretation of affective information is an important factor in social interactions and everyday functioning, and difficulties in these areas may contribute to aetiology and maintenance of mental health conditions. In younger people with depression and anxiety, research suggests significant alterations in behavioural and brain activation aspects of emotion processing, with a tendency to appraise neutral stimuli as negative and attend preferentially to negative stimuli. However, in ageing, research suggests that emotion processing becomes subject to a 'positivity effect', whereby older people attend more to positive than negative stimuli.

AIMS

This review examines data from studies of emotion processing in Late-Life Depression and Late-Life Anxiety to attempt to understand the significance of emotion processing variations in these conditions, and their interaction with changes in emotion processing that occur with ageing.

METHOD

We conducted a systematic review following PRISMA guidelines. Articles that used an emotion-based processing task, examined older persons with depression or an anxiety disorder and included a healthy control group were included.

RESULTS

In Late-Life Depression, there is little consistent behavioural evidence of impaired emotion processing, but there is evidence of altered brain circuitry during these processes. In Late-Life Anxiety and Post-Traumatic Stress disorder, there is evidence of interference with processing of negative or threat-related words.

CONCLUSIONS

How these findings fit with the positivity bias of ageing is not clear. Future research is required in larger groups, further examining the interaction between illness and age and the significance of age at disease onset.

摘要

背景

情感认知以及对情感信息的有效解读是社交互动和日常功能中的一个重要因素,这些方面的困难可能导致心理健康状况的病因及维持。对于患有抑郁症和焦虑症的年轻人,研究表明在情绪加工的行为和大脑激活方面存在显著改变,倾向于将中性刺激评估为负面,并优先关注负面刺激。然而,在老龄化过程中,研究表明情绪加工会受到“积极效应”的影响,即老年人对积极刺激的关注多于负面刺激。

目的

本综述考察了老年期抑郁症和老年期焦虑症情绪加工研究的数据,试图了解这些情况下情绪加工变化的意义,以及它们与老龄化过程中情绪加工变化的相互作用。

方法

我们按照PRISMA指南进行了系统综述。纳入了使用基于情绪的加工任务、研究患有抑郁症或焦虑症的老年人且包括健康对照组的文章。

结果

在老年期抑郁症中,几乎没有一致的行为证据表明情绪加工受损,但有证据表明在这些过程中大脑回路发生了改变。在老年期焦虑症和创伤后应激障碍中,有证据表明对负面或与威胁相关词语的加工受到干扰。

结论

这些发现如何与老龄化的积极偏差相契合尚不清楚。未来需要在更大的群体中进行研究,进一步考察疾病与年龄之间的相互作用以及疾病发病时年龄的意义。
